After India's defeat in the second test match against South Africa, now the big news is coming out about the injured captain Virat Kohli. Team India coach Rahul Dravid has given a big update about Virat's fitness in the press conference, after which the chances of Virat's return to the team in the third Test have increased.
Captain Virat Kohli was ruled out of Team India in the second Test due to injury. KL Rahul took over the command of the team. India lost this match by 7 wickets. Now the series between the two teams is tied at 1-1.
Dravid said during the press conference, 'The way Kohli is practicing in the nets, he looks fit. Though I haven't discussed it with the physio so far, what I hear and what I feel from having conversations with Kohli suggests that the Indian Test captain is fit.
Johannesburg Test not played due to back stiffness
Virat Kohli could not play in the second test due to stiffness in the back. A few minutes before the toss, the news of Virat's exit from this match came to the fore. KL Rahul came for the toss in his place. Rahul told that Kohli has been ruled out of this test due to stiffness in the upper back.
Dravid's statement clearly shows that Virat Kohli can return in the third and last Test of the series to be played in Cape Town.
India's first defeat in Johannesburg
This is the Indian team's first defeat in 29 years at the Wanderers Stadium in Johannesburg. Team India played the first Test at this ground in the year 1992. That match was a draw. Before this match, India had won two of the five-Test matches played here, while three matches were drawn. In 29 years, the South African team had never been able to beat the Indian team, but on Thursday, the series was broken.
In the absence of unfit Virat Kohli, Rahul was captained for the first time and he had to face defeat in this match.
This is Rahul Dravid's first defeat as a coach. The lack of enthusiasm in the bowlers was visible due to Kohli's absence. At the same time, there was no edge in the captaincy of Rahul. If Kohli makes a comeback in the third Test, then Team India would like to win this Test match and win the Test series on African soil for the first time.
